Severe disease — Patients with severe ulcerative colitis usually have a large region of the colon involved, often the entire colon. Symptoms of severe ulcerative colitis include Diagram of the colon and rectum Ulcerative Colitis (UC) is a disease in which the lining of the colon (the large intestine) becomes inflamed. The immune system mistakenly targets the lining of the colon, causing inflammation, ulceration, bleeding and diarrhea. The inflammation almost always affects the rectum and lower part of the colon, but it can also effect the entire colon
